Cleaning Air With Ozone

Prozone PurifierOzone, once created by the air purifier, is sent out to the room where it reacts with the pollutants contained in the air. The ozone acts to break down these pollutants through oxidization and therefore turning them into carbon dioxide and ash which are negatively charged. With this, these non-harmful ashes can be cleaned together with other particles when the room is cleaned. Through this process, the air purifier works to destroy dust, pollen, mold, dust and smoke which is found in the environment indoors. The Prozone air purifier also does not require any filters to be replaced and nothing to be cleaned.

Types Of Prozone Air Purifiers

There are two types of Prozone purifiers available: room air purifiers and purifiers for the whole house. The room air purifier is designed to be portable and to be turned off and on whenever air needs to be cleaned. On the other hand, the Prozone air filter for the whole house contains two UV-C lamps and allows ozone to be turned off or on. Furthermore, this air purifier is designed to operate continuously as well as independently.

Finally, as the purifier utilizes ozone to clean the air, this has caused concern amongst certain groups of consumers. This is because ozone has been found to be a lung irritant and is also not environmentally friendly. Apart from that, the safe levels of ozone emitted by the Prozone air purifiers is debatable, as well as the uncertainty surrounding its ability to break down the pollutants.
